Abstract in English
According to Augustine, man was created a way that his happiness consists on meeting again with his creator, God. In this sense, the return corresponds to a human itinerary by grades, which, as they are surpassed, became inner and higher. In the book X of the Confessions, the relationship between God and man happens and is treated in terms of memory and forgetfulness: human memory and forgetfulness of himself and of God as though as divine memory and forgetfulness towards man
